Post by truegrit on Apr 12, 2007 21:04:08 GMT -4
we also saw a all black ringneck rooster, back in october of this year, and once again, we didn't have our camera in the truck, it was on the side of the road in a field with another ringneck rooster(normal) colored one, anyway, mrlongbeard called the 'pgc" and the "phesants forever" and they told him it was a recessive gene, called melonistic, i know i spelled that word wrong. they said they might of stocked it, they said only 1 in 10 to 15 thousand birds is that black color.
